Revitalize Bald Patches with Micropigmentation
Micropigmentation presents a subtle solution for individuals experiencing hair loss. This minimally invasive procedure involves the insertion of tiny pigments into the upper layers of the scalp, simulating the appearance of natural hair follicles.
Depending on individual needs and preferences, micropigmentation can be utilized to create a realistic hair density. The results are often durable, requiring minimal maintenance down the line.
Hairline Revival: A Scalp Tattoo Solution for Alopecia
Facing the challenges of alopecia can be a deeply emotional experience. Many individuals seek solutions to restore their confidence and enhance their self-image.
Among the innovative approaches available, scalp tattooing has emerged as a revolutionary treatment for those affected alopecia. This non-surgical procedure involves using specialized tattoo techniques to create the illusion of realistic hair follicles on the scalp.
By strategically implanting pigment into the skin, a skilled technician can simulate the appearance of hair growth, effectively concealing bald patches and enhancing the overall hairline.
